In your last 23 basketball games, you attempted 101 free throws and made 66. Find the experimental probability that you make a free throw. Write the probability as a percent, to the nearest tenth of a percent. Please no answers given just trying to find the equation and help me find the answer myself.
experimental probability is found by taking the number of successful free throws and dividing by the total number of free throws.
then convert to a percent, rounding to the nearest 10th of a percent
For example, if you wanted to find the experimental probability that you could sink a game-winning shot by hurling the ball the length of the court, you might spend an hour in the gym trying it. If you threw the ball down the court 150 times, and you made the basket 2 times, your experimental probability would be 2/150 = 0.013333 or about 1.3%.
